2005 Mazda Carol 660 G special Specs
OVERVIEW
With a fuel consumption of 48 mpg US - 57.6 mpg UK - 4.9 L/100km, a weight of 1631 lbs (740 kg), the Mazda Carol 660 G special has a 3 cylinder DOHC engine, a Regular gasoline engine K6A. This engine K6A produces a maximum power of 54.7 PS (54 bhp - 40.2 kW) at 6500 rpm and a maximum torque of 60.8 Nm (44.8 lb.ft - 6.2 kg.m) at 4000 rpm. The engine power is transmitted to the road by the front wheel drive (FF) with a 3AT gearbox. For stopping power, the Mazda Carol 660 G special braking system includes drum at the rear and disk at the front. Stock tire sizes are 155/65 on 13 inch rims at the rear and 155/65 on 13 inch rims at the front. Chassis details - Mazda Carol 660 G special has isolated trailing link type rear suspension and strut front suspension for road holding and ride confort.

Wheel Options and Tire Sizes
The 2005-2006 Mazda Carol 660 G Special offered specific wheel options and tire sizes to complement its design and performance. The standard wheel dimensions for this model featured 155/65 R13 tires.These tires provided a good balance between comfort and agility, making them suitable for city driving and everyday use. The tire size 155/65 R13 indicated a width of 155 mm, a sidewall height that is 65% of the tire's width, and compatibility with 13-inch diameter wheels.
The 155/65 R13 tire size offered decent grip and traction on various road surfaces, ensuring stability and confident handling. The tires were designed to deliver a comfortable ride quality while maintaining good fuel efficiency.
